Half Year 2026 Alstom SA Earnings Call Transcript
Key Points
- Alstom SA (ALSMY) reported strong commercial momentum with orders reaching EUR10.5 billion, driven by Rolling Stock and North America.
- The company achieved a book-to-bill ratio of 1.2, aligning with full-year guidance.
- Sales increased by 7.9% organically to EUR9.1 billion, with contributions from all product lines and regions.
- Adjusted EBIT rose by 13% year-on-year to EUR580 million, improving the margin from 5.9% to 6.4%.
- The integration of Bombardier Transportation is complete, allowing Alstom SA (ALSMY) to focus on industrial and development performance improvements.
- Free cash flow was negative EUR740 million, reflecting higher seasonality and typical cash flow patterns.
- The gross margin slightly decreased to 13.6% due to regional mix headwinds, despite improvements in project execution.
- The company faces headwinds from foreign exchange impacts, affecting both sales and adjusted EBIT margins.
- Contract working capital was a EUR1.2 billion headwind, driven by the ramp-up phase of Rolling Stock projects.
- Net financial debt increased to EUR1.4 billion, up from EUR434 million at the end of March, due to free cash flow changes and other financial activities.
